Petit Bourgeoisie
The petit bourgeoisie typically refers to the lower middle class segment in society, often engaged in small-scale businesses or entrepreneurial ventures, possessing modest socioeconomic status.
Gini Index
A measure of the inequality of wealth or income distribution within a country.
Kuznet Curve
An economic theory that suggests inequality increases in the early stages of a country's development but decreases as the country becomes more economically advanced.
Feminization of Poverty
The feminization of poverty refers to the phenomenon where women represent a disproportionate percentage of the world's poor, often attributed to wage disparity, unemployment, and the burden of single parenthood.
